+# Enable use of filtered logging library
+# Valid options: YES, NO, AUTO (highly recommended)
+NETSURF_USE_NSLOG := AUTO
+# The minimum logging level *compiled* into netsurf
+# Valid options are: DEEPDEBUG, DEBUG, VERBOSE, INFO, WARNING, ERROR, CRITICAL
+NETSURF_LOG_LEVEL := INFO
+# The log filter set during log initialisation before options are available
+NETSURF_BUILTIN_LOG_FILTER := level:WARNING
+# The log filter set during log initialisation before options are available
+# if the logging level is set to verbose
+NETSURF_BUILTIN_VERBOSE_FILTER := level:VERBOSE
